Key Position Details:

  • Job Title: Consultant (MP-II)
  • Department: Ministry of Law and Justice
  • Location: Islamabad, Pakistan
  • Contract Duration: 3 Years (extendable)
  • Required Qualification: Ph.D. in Law with 5 years of professional experience OR Master's in Law with 7 years of professional experience.
  • Age Limit: 62 Years
  • Key Responsibilities: Drafting, reviewing legal documents, and providing expert opinions.

Skills

  • Excellent communication skills
  • Interpersonal skills
  • Ability to communicate effectively at national and international fora
  • Commitment to professionalism, discipline, and integrity
  • Strong leadership skills
  • Ability to work effectively in a team
  • Experience of drafting or reviewing Conventions, Agreements, MOUs, Contracts and other legal documents
  • Preferably having an understanding of International Law and skills of rendering legal opinion on policy and regulatory matters
  • Experience in legislative drafting

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Reviewing Conventions, Agreements, MOUs, Contracts and other legal documents
  • Rendering legal opinion on policy and regulatory matters
  • Engaging in legislative drafting

How to apply

  • Application Portal: Interested candidates must apply through the official National Job Portal at www.nip.gov.pk.
  • Application Deadline: Ensure your application is submitted within fifteen (15) days from the date of this advertisement's publication.
  • NOC Requirement: Government servants are mandated to submit a No Objection Certificate (NOC) from their present employer at the time of application.
  • Interview Process: The Ministry reserves the right to cancel or postpone recruitment. Shortlisted candidates will be contacted for an interview.
  • Required Documents for Interview: Applicants must bring original educational certificates, law transcripts, experience certificates, a detailed CV, and passport-size photos.
  • Selection Committee: Final candidates will be interviewed by the Selection Committee.
  • Contact Information: For inquiries, contact the Section Officer (Admn-VII) at the Ministry of Law and Justice, Islamabad.
